What we Know so Far
- The Clermont Toyota Tundra will be entering a new design generation that features a totally upgraded exterior style. The front end is more aggressive, larger, and very embossed. It features new headlights, an LED light bar just below the “TUNDRA” name. The photo released by Toyota shows a short bed design with more body lines and a boxy shape. The wheel weld arches also features a new trim feature we weren’t expecting. This is all new!
- As for the engine, we know that it’ll be the first of a new era for the iForce line. It will be called the iForce MAX, that we know for sure.

What we Don’t Know for Sure
- There’s still quite a lot that’s speculative surrounding the Clermont Toyota Tundra. One thing, the engine and drivetrain. Many industry journalism outlets have honed in on the inclusion of a V6 engine of some type. It’s also been speculated that the Tundra could see a hybrid drivetrain included for the new model year.
- We don’t know what the interior looks like just yet. Our guess here at Toyota of Clermont is that the Tundra will be getting several luxurious touches along with new upholstery that could change depending on trim grade. Toyota also published a press release detailing their next generation of infotainment system. Will this system make its way into the new Toyota Tundra? Hard to say until we know more.
- How many trim grades can we expect to see? Typically, Toyota includes a wide variety of trim grades for the Tacoma and Tundra and likely will do the same this time around. Judging from the photo we can likely expect a TRD version. As for the rest, we’ll have to wait and see!
